Unlocking the Potential of Visual Narrative Techniques


Visual narrative techniques are the secret sauce behind compelling brand stories. They combine imagery, composition, and emotion to create a seamless flow that pulls viewers in. Think of it as a dance between what you show and what you want your audience to feel.


Here’s why they matter:


  • Instant engagement: People process images faster than text. A striking visual can grab attention in a split second.

  • Emotional connection: Images evoke feelings. They can inspire trust, excitement, or curiosity.

  • Memorability: Stories told visually stick in the mind longer than facts alone.

  • Brand differentiation: Unique visuals set you apart in crowded markets.


To get started, focus on these key elements:


  1. Composition - How you arrange elements in your frame guides the viewer’s eye.

  2. Colour - Use colour strategically to evoke mood and reinforce brand identity.

  3. Lighting - Light shapes perception. It can highlight, soften, or dramatise.

  4. Perspective - The camera angle influences how your subject is perceived.

  5. Consistency - A coherent visual style builds recognition and trust.


Mastering these basics will give your brand a powerful visual voice.

What is visual storytelling?


At its core, visual storytelling is the art of conveying a narrative through images rather than words alone. It’s about crafting a sequence or a single image that tells a story, sparks imagination, and invites interpretation.


Imagine a brand video that doesn’t just show products but reveals the lifestyle, values, and emotions behind them. Or a photo series that captures moments of triumph, struggle, or innovation. That’s visual storytelling in action.


It’s not just about aesthetics. It’s about meaning. Every frame, every shot, every detail contributes to a larger narrative. When done right, it transforms passive viewers into active participants in your brand’s journey.


Here’s how to think about it:


  • Characters: Who or what is the focus? People, products, places?

  • Setting: Where does the story unfold? Context matters.

  • Plot: What’s happening? Is there a conflict, a resolution, a transformation?

  • Emotion: What feelings do you want to evoke?

  • Pacing: How does the story flow? Is it fast, slow, dramatic?


By answering these questions, you create visuals that resonate on a deeper level.

Practical ways to apply visual narrative techniques


You don’t need a Hollywood budget to tell powerful stories visually. Here are actionable tips to get you started:


1. Plan your story before shooting


Outline the key message and emotions you want to convey. Sketch a storyboard or create a mood board. This keeps your visuals focused and purposeful.


2. Use natural light whenever possible


Natural light adds authenticity and warmth. Shoot during golden hours (early morning or late afternoon) for soft, flattering light.


3. Experiment with angles and perspectives


Don’t settle for eye-level shots only. Try high angles to show scale or vulnerability, low angles to convey power or dominance.


4. Incorporate movement


Movement adds life. Capture flowing fabric, bustling streets, or dynamic gestures to create energy.


5. Keep backgrounds simple


Avoid clutter that distracts from your subject. A clean background helps your message stand out.


6. Use colour psychology


Choose colours that align with your brand personality and the mood you want to evoke. Blues can feel trustworthy, reds energising, greens calming.


7. Edit with intention


Post-production is your chance to enhance mood and consistency. Adjust contrast, saturation, and sharpness carefully.


8. Tell a story with a series


Sometimes one image isn’t enough. Use a sequence of photos or video clips to build a narrative arc.


9. Include human elements


Even a single person in your visuals can create relatability and emotional depth.


10. Test and refine


Gather feedback and analyse engagement. Learn what resonates and refine your approach.


By applying these techniques, you’ll create visuals that don’t just look good but feel good.

Elevate your brand with cinematic visuals


The power of cinematic visuals lies in their ability to immerse and captivate. They combine storytelling with artistry, creating an experience rather than just content.


Here’s how to bring cinematic quality to your brand:


  • Story-driven scripts: Start with a compelling narrative.

  • Professional lighting and sound: These elevate production value.

  • Dynamic camera work: Use movement, focus shifts, and framing creatively.

  • Colour grading: Consistent tones set mood and style.

  • Post-production polish: Editing, effects, and sound design complete the picture.


Cinematic visuals make your brand memorable. They invite your audience to feel your story, not just see it.
